QTextEdit大文件支持

QTextEdit大文件支持,qt,Qt,两者都有一个方法,允许您为小部件实现数据提供者,但没有这样的方法 如何在文本文档上实现滑动窗口视图,以便管理支持小部件的数据?什么是“大文件”,有多大?QTextEdit不是用于将其线拆分为模型的。你需要编辑数据还是只读数据?我不认为给你数字能澄清这个问题。我正在寻找一种在QTextEdit上实现模型视图控制器或模型视图委托的方法。因为您试图滥用组件来实现它不适用的功能。因此,如果你希望人们帮助你进行黑客攻击,你需要提供更多的信息。你可以认为文件的大小是无限的。我想向用户显示一个数据窗口,让他们

两者都有一个方法,允许您为小部件实现数据提供者,但没有这样的方法


如何在文本文档上实现滑动窗口视图,以便管理支持小部件的数据?

什么是“大文件”,有多大?QTextEdit不是用于将其线拆分为模型的。你需要编辑数据还是只读数据?我不认为给你数字能澄清这个问题。我正在寻找一种在QTextEdit上实现模型视图控制器或模型视图委托的方法。因为您试图滥用组件来实现它不适用的功能。因此,如果你希望人们帮助你进行黑客攻击,你需要提供更多的信息。你可以认为文件的大小是无限的。我想向用户显示一个数据窗口,让他们能够操作和选择文本。这不一定需要QTextEdit,但QTable或QTree是不够的。我也研究过这一点,但遗憾的是,有一个硬连接的假设,即所有文本都在内存中,并且块的数量是已知的。因此,您必须自己管理窗口,在一端附加/预加块,在用户移动时在另一端删除它们。我希望这是比“组件滥用”指控更清楚的解释。